diff options
author | groditi <groditi@03d0b0b2-0e1a-0410-a411-fdb2f4bd65d7> | 2008-09-03 23:31:05 +0000 |
---|---|---|
committer | groditi <groditi@03d0b0b2-0e1a-0410-a411-fdb2f4bd65d7> | 2008-09-03 23:31:05 +0000 |
commit | c72dfafbadfab903436fa033833a63270616bb22 (patch) | |
tree | d8ab2e5ad5b7d40cb315c2f15ebef55954645c2f /lib/Reaction/UI/Widget | |
parent | d31723749bd4ae2052c628b99b90d3b453ddf0e6 (diff) | |
download | reaction-c72dfafbadfab903436fa033833a63270616bb22.tar.gz reaction-c72dfafbadfab903436fa033833a63270616bb22.zip |
no foo is required messages on the first render
Diffstat (limited to 'lib/Reaction/UI/Widget')
-rw-r--r-- | lib/Reaction/UI/Widget/Field/Mutable.pm |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/lib/Reaction/UI/Widget/Field/Mutable.pm b/lib/Reaction/UI/Widget/Field/Mutable.pm index 1364b39..2626987 100644 --- a/lib/Reaction/UI/Widget/Field/Mutable.pm +++ b/lib/Reaction/UI/Widget/Field/Mutable.pm @@ -23,7 +23,8 @@ extends 'Reaction::UI::Widget::Field'; implements fragment message_fragment { my $vp = $_{viewport}; - my $message = $_{viewport}->message; + return unless $vp->has_message; + my $message = $vp->message; $message ||= $vp->name.' is required' if $vp->value_is_required && !$vp->value_string; if ($message) { |